Abstract

The utility model discloses a kind of parallelly-arranged double-row floor detection mechanism, including detecting casing, part standing groove and clamping hydraulic cylinder to be detected, the detection box house is provided with detection clamping device, the detection clamping device is by bottom hydraulic oil pump, part standing groove to be detected, part to be detected places plate, head part, replaceable head part installed part, side hydraulic oil pump, clamping hydraulic cylinder, clamp hydraulic piston connecting rod, support hydraulic pressure piston rod and supporting cylinder composition, the detection clamping device front end is provided with detection camera, the detection camera is by camera installing plate, camera installed part and detachable camera composition, the camera installing plate is fixed on part standing groove interior forward end to be detected, the camera installation front edge of board is provided with two camera installed parts, the camera installed part front end is provided with detachable camera.The utility model can carry out the detection of the bottom flatness of various different parts, by dual camera, Detection results can be made more preferable.

Refer to Fig. 1-3, a kind of embodiment provided by the utility model:A kind of parallelly-arranged double-row floor detection mechanism, including Casing 2, part standing groove 8 to be detected and clamping hydraulic cylinder 13 are detected, detects and detection clamping device 5, detection is installed inside casing 2 Clamping device 5 can be clamped part to be detected, be easy to detect bottom, detection clamping device 5 is by bottom hydraulic oil pump 7th, part standing groove 8 to be detected, part to be detected place plate 9, head part 10, replaceable head part installed part 11, side hydraulic oil pump 12, clamping Hydraulic cylinder 13, clamping hydraulic piston connecting rod 14, support hydraulic pressure piston rod 15 and supporting cylinder 16 form, and detect clamping device 5 front ends are provided with detection camera 4, and detection camera 4 can carry out the detection of feature bottom, and detection camera 4 is by camera Installing plate 17, camera installed part 18 and detachable camera 19 form, and camera installing plate 17 is fixed on part to be detected and placed The interior forward end of groove 8, the front end of camera installing plate 17 are provided with two camera installed parts 18, the installation of the front end of camera installed part 18 There is detachable camera 19, two detachable cameras 19 can carry out double detection, the effect of detection can be made more preferable;
The opening position at detection casing 2 four angles in bottom is mounted on support column 1, and the lower end of part standing groove 8 to be detected is provided with Part to be detected can be placed plate 9 and be lifted by supporting cylinder 16, supporting cylinder 16, and the side of supporting cylinder 16 is provided with Bottom hydraulic oil pump 7, support hydraulic pressure piston rod 15, the top of support hydraulic pressure piston rod 15 are installed inside supporting cylinder 16 Part to be detected is installed and places plate 9, part to be detected places plate 9 can provide the plane of a support for part, and part to be detected is put Put the both ends of groove 8 and be mounted on clamping hydraulic cylinder 13, clamping hydraulic cylinder 13 can release head part 10, and part to be detected is carried out Fixed, the upper end of clamping hydraulic cylinder 13 is mounted on side hydraulic oil pump 12, clamping hydraulic piston is provided with inside clamping hydraulic cylinder 13 Connecting rod 14, the end of clamping hydraulic piston connecting rod 14 are provided with replaceable head part installed part 11, the replaceable end of head part installed part 11 Head part 10 is installed, head part 10 can be clamped part to be detected, and detection casing 2 upper end side is provided with light filling equipment 6, Light filling equipment 6 can carry out light filling when insufficient light, and the detection upper end opposite side of casing 2 is provided with LCDs 3, LCDs 3 can all feed back the information detected above, and the graphical information that can detect detection camera 4 Shown.
Specifically used mode:In utility model works, part to be detected is placed on part to be detected and places plate 9 by user Upper end, support hydraulic pressure piston rod 15 is ejected by supporting cylinder 16, part to be detected placement plate 9 is lifted and taken the photograph with detection When being in same level as first 4, stop;
Head part 10 is ejected by clamping hydraulic cylinder 13 again, part to be detected is clamped by head part 10, clamped Afterwards, part to be detected is placed plate 9 and can reclaimed in the presence of supporting cylinder 16, now, by detecting two in camera 4 Detachable camera 19 is detected, and the information detected is all shown on LCDs 3;
The band detection part being clamped among head part 10 can also be entered by being acted on while two clamping hydraulic cylinder 13 The horizontal movement of row, detachable camera 19 can be detected whole bottom, so far, the workflow of whole equipment is complete Into.
